Registered Agent Requirements by Region

Every state in the United States has distinct criteria for registered agents that businesses must adhere to when forming either a company or an LLC. Typically, a registered agent must be a inhabitant of the state or a business entity legally registered to operate there. This means that companies often have to select a trustworthy individual or business registered agent located within the state to accept legal documents, official notices, and other correspondence on behalf of the company.

In besides residency requirements, various states mandate that the registered agent provide a real address (known as the registered office) where documents can be delivered. P.O. Box addresses generally do not meet this requirement. Some states impose additional stipulations regarding the hours of operation for the registered office, making certain that the agent is available during regular business hours for the delivery of service of process and other critical documents.

Moreover, specific compliance obligations can vary significantly by state. For example, some states require registered agents to file an annual report or inform the state of any alterations in their status or address. Noncompliance with these rules can lead to penalties or even cancellation of the business entity. Thus, understanding and following these requirements is essential for businesses aiming to maintain good standing and protective measures.

Frequent FAQs About Designated Agents

Numerous business entrepreneurs have questions about the function and importance of registered agent services. One frequent inquiry is, what precisely does a registered agent perform? A registered agent serves as an agent for service of process, receiving court papers and official correspondence on behalf of a business entity. This role guarantees that critical notifications, such as lawsuits or compliance documents, are accepted in a timely manner, which helps maintain the business’s legal standing.

Another common question relates to the requirements for registered agents. Each state has distinct registered agent requirements that must be fulfilled. Generally, a registered agent must have a tangible address within the state of registration and be available during regular business hours. Some business owners ask if they can serve as their own registered agent; while this is allowed in numerous states, it is often advised to engage a professional registered agent for the benefit of confidentiality and efficiency.
